Mutual dialogue to address border issues: General Secretary Pokharel



MAHOTTARI: General Secretary of the CPN UML, Shankar Pokharel, has said both neighbours, India and China, ignored the sensitivity of Nepal’s concern while making agreement to open the India-China route via Limpiyadhura border point for trade.

At a press conference organized by Press Chautari in Bardibas on Thursday, General Secretary Pokharel asserted, “Nepal has prepared its map based on facts and truth that the land towards Nepal from the Mahakali River belongs to Nepali territory. It is as per the Sugauli Treaty, 1816.”

Pokharel further said Nepal wants to address the problem through mutual dialogue and discussion.

Prime Minister KP Sharma Oli’s visits to India and China would be held as per preparation, he asserted.
